In the context of removal, or reduction in the use of plant protection products, cover crops, which are known to confer several benefits to soil, have been suggested as a potential agronomic intervention to manage soil-borne plant-parasitic nematodes. However, to date, cover crops have delivered a range of outcomes including nematode suppression, enhancement or no effect on target nematodes perhaps due to most studies being based on a single year with limited sampling (typically pre-sowing, post-harvest). In this study, over a 3-year period we sampled temporally (∼ every 3 weeks), to assess the effects of several cover crops on plant-parasitic nematodes and the wider nematode community. Using a constrained analysis of principal coordinates, two cover crop treatments Viterra Intensiv and Biofumigation Mix, had a greater association with plant-parasitic nematode genera whereas there was an absence of beneficial predatory genera associated with Viterra Intensiv and Oilseed radish cv. Defender. The remaining three cover crop treatments (Oilseed radish cv. Bento, a Vetch/Rye mixture and Phacelia ) had no effect compared with the barley control. Not constraining the data by the barley control resulted in a significant month/crop interaction (p < 0.001) with clear temporal effects on the relative abundance of ( Para ) Trichodorus and Pratylenchus associated with several cover crops. The differential effects of cover crops in this study concurs with previous studies and highlights that the use of cover crops to manage plant-parasitic nematodes has variable outcomes. Thus, more research is required to fully understand whether cover crops are a viable efficacious alternative to manage plant-parasitic nematodes. • Cover crops elicit different responses in soil nematode communities. • Key plant-parasitic nematode genera are strongly associated with two cover crops, Viterra Intensiv and Biofumigation Mix. • Oilseed radish cv. Bento, Phacelia and a Vetch/Rye mixture had no detectable effect on nematode community composition.
